How they compare
Poland currently reports 848,491 Million euro against 797,328 Million euro in Bayern, a difference of 51,163 Million euro.
That makes Poland's figure about 1.1 times Bayern's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Bayern ahead.
Bayern ranks 5th and Poland ranks 8th of 372 regions.
Bayern has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bayern | Poland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 403,147 Million euro | 253,495 Million euro | 149,653 Million euro | Bayern |
| 2010s | 556,152 Million euro | 429,858 Million euro | 126,294 Million euro | Bayern |
| 2020s | 724,339 Million euro | 675,393 Million euro | 48,946 Million euro | Bayern |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
